Memahami Konsep Platform Orkestrasi Alur Kerja Data Real-Time
Di era digital yang berkembang pesat ini, platform untuk orkestrasi alur kerja data real-time telah menjadi tulang punggung infrastruktur teknologi informasi modern. Platform ini memungkinkan organisasi untuk mengelola, memproses, dan menganalisis data secara langsung tanpa penundaan yang signifikan. Konsep real-time dalam konteks ini merujuk pada kemampuan sistem untuk memproses data dalam hitungan detik atau milidetik setelah data tersebut diterima.
Orkestrasi alur kerja data merupakan proses koordinasi yang kompleks yang melibatkan berbagai komponen sistem untuk bekerja secara harmonis. Platform ini bertindak sebagai konduktor orkestra yang mengatur kapan, bagaimana, dan di mana setiap proses data harus dijalankan. Hal ini sangat penting dalam lingkungan bisnis yang membutuhkan respons cepat terhadap perubahan kondisi pasar atau kebutuhan operasional.
Komponen Utama dalam Sistem Orkestrasi Data
Sebuah platform orkestrasi yang efektif terdiri dari beberapa komponen krusial yang bekerja secara sinergis. Data ingestion engine berfungsi sebagai gerbang masuk yang mengumpulkan data dari berbagai sumber seperti database, API, file log, dan sensor IoT. Komponen ini harus mampu menangani volume data yang besar dengan kecepatan tinggi sambil mempertahankan integritas data.
Komponen kedua adalah processing engine yang bertanggung jawab untuk mentransformasi, membersihkan, dan memperkaya data. Engine ini menggunakan algoritma yang canggih untuk memastikan data yang diproses memiliki kualitas tinggi dan format yang konsisten. Selanjutnya, routing mechanism menentukan jalur yang tepat untuk setiap jenis data berdasarkan aturan bisnis yang telah ditetapkan.
Komponen monitoring dan alerting memungkinkan administrator sistem untuk memantau kinerja platform secara real-time. Sistem ini dapat mendeteksi anomali, bottleneck, atau kegagalan sistem dan memberikan notifikasi segera kepada tim teknis. Terakhir, komponen storage dan output management mengatur penyimpanan data yang telah diproses dan mendistribusikannya ke sistem tujuan yang memerlukan.
Arsitektur Microservices dalam Platform Orkestrasi
Arsitektur microservices telah menjadi standar industri untuk platform orkestrasi modern karena fleksibilitas dan skalabilitasnya. Dalam arsitektur ini, setiap fungsi atau layanan diimplementasikan sebagai unit independen yang dapat dikembangkan, di-deploy, dan di-scale secara terpisah. Pendekatan ini memungkinkan organisasi untuk mengoptimalkan setiap komponen sesuai dengan kebutuhan spesifik mereka.
Container technology seperti Docker dan Kubernetes memainkan peran penting dalam implementasi arsitektur microservices. Container menyediakan lingkungan yang terisolasi dan konsisten untuk menjalankan setiap service, sementara Kubernetes mengatur orkestrasi container dalam skala besar. Kombinasi ini menghasilkan sistem yang highly available, fault-tolerant, dan mudah untuk di-maintain.
Keunggulan Implementasi Platform Orkestrasi Real-Time
Implementasi platform orkestrasi alur kerja data real-time memberikan berbagai keunggulan signifikan bagi organisasi modern. Peningkatan efisiensi operasional menjadi benefit utama karena otomasi proses yang sebelumnya memerlukan intervensi manual. Sistem dapat menjalankan tugas-tugas kompleks secara otomatis berdasarkan trigger yang telah ditentukan, mengurangi waktu response dan human error.
Keunggulan kedua adalah skalabilitas horizontal yang memungkinkan sistem untuk menangani peningkatan volume data tanpa degradasi performa yang signifikan. Platform modern dapat secara otomatis menambah atau mengurangi resource computing berdasarkan beban kerja aktual, mengoptimalkan penggunaan infrastruktur dan biaya operasional.
Aspek keamanan data juga mengalami peningkatan dramatis dengan implementasi platform orkestrasi yang proper. Sistem dapat menerapkan enkripsi end-to-end, access control yang granular, dan audit trail yang komprehensif untuk memastikan data sensitif terlindungi sepanjang alur kerja. Compliance dengan regulasi seperti GDPR atau SOX menjadi lebih mudah dicapai dengan fitur-fitur keamanan yang terintegrasi.
ROI dan Dampak Bisnis
Dari perspektif return on investment, platform orkestrasi data real-time dapat memberikan ROI yang signifikan dalam jangka pendek hingga menengah. Pengurangan waktu pemrosesan data dari jam menjadi menit atau detik dapat menghasilkan keunggulan kompetitif yang substansial, terutama dalam industri yang time-sensitive seperti finansial atau e-commerce.
Kualitas keputusan bisnis juga mengalami peningkatan karena tersedianya data yang fresh dan akurat. Manager dapat membuat keputusan strategis berdasarkan informasi real-time tentang kondisi pasar, perilaku customer, atau performa operasional. Hal ini sangat krusial dalam lingkungan bisnis yang dinamis dan kompetitif.
Teknologi dan Tools Populer untuk Orkestrasi Data
Landscape teknologi untuk orkestrasi alur kerja data sangat beragam, mulai dari solusi open source hingga platform enterprise yang fully managed. Apache Airflow merupakan salah satu tools open source paling populer yang menyediakan framework untuk mendefinisikan, scheduling, dan monitoring workflow. Airflow menggunakan Python sebagai bahasa pemrograman utama dan menyediakan web interface yang user-friendly untuk manajemen workflow.
Untuk organisasi yang membutuhkan solusi cloud-native, Apache Kafka combined dengan Kafka Streams atau Apache Flink menyediakan platform streaming yang powerful untuk real-time data processing. Kombinasi ini memungkinkan processing data dengan latency yang sangat rendah dan throughput yang tinggi, ideal untuk use case seperti fraud detection atau real-time analytics.
Platform enterprise seperti Databricks, Snowflake, atau Google Cloud Dataflow menawarkan solusi managed yang mengurangi kompleksitas operational overhead. Platform ini menyediakan auto-scaling, built-in security, dan integration yang seamless dengan ecosystem cloud yang lebih luas. Meskipun memiliki biaya yang lebih tinggi, platform managed ini dapat mempercepat time-to-market dan mengurangi resource requirement untuk maintenance.
Kriteria Pemilihan Platform yang Tepat
Pemilihan platform orkestrasi yang tepat memerlukan evaluasi mendalam terhadap berbagai faktor teknis dan bisnis. Skalabilitas menjadi faktor utama yang harus dipertimbangkan, terutama terkait kemampuan platform untuk menangani pertumbuhan volume data di masa depan. Platform yang dipilih harus dapat scale both vertically dan horizontally tanpa requiring major architectural changes.
Faktor kedua adalah ecosystem integration yang menentukan seberapa mudah platform dapat berintegrasi dengan existing systems dan tools. Platform yang memiliki connector yang luas dan API yang well-documented akan mempermudah proses implementasi dan reduce integration complexity. Consideration terhadap vendor lock-in juga penting untuk memastikan fleksibilitas di masa depan.
Implementasi dan Best Practices
Proses implementasi platform orkestrasi alur kerja data real-time memerlukan perencanaan yang matang dan eksekusi yang sistematis. Phase pertama adalah assessment terhadap current state infrastructure dan identification terhadap use cases yang akan diprioritaskan. Assessment ini harus mencakup evaluasi terhadap data sources, volume, velocity, dan variety data yang akan diproses.
Phase kedua melibatkan design arsitektur yang detail, termasuk pemilihan technology stack, definition data models, dan establishment governance framework. Penting untuk melibatkan stakeholders dari berbagai departemen untuk memastikan solution yang didesain dapat memenuhi requirement bisnis yang comprehensive.
Testing strategy juga krusial dalam implementation process. Platform harus ditest dalam berbagai scenario termasuk normal load, peak load, dan failure conditions. Load testing dan chaos engineering dapat membantu identify potential issues sebelum system go-live. Implementation harus dilakukan secara incremental dengan continuous monitoring untuk memastikan system stability.
Monitoring dan Maintenance
Setelah platform beroperasi, monitoring dan maintenance yang proaktif menjadi kunci untuk memastikan performance yang optimal. Key performance indicators seperti throughput, latency, error rate, dan resource utilization harus dipantau secara kontinyu. Dashboard yang comprehensive dapat memberikan visibility real-time terhadap system health dan performance metrics.
Maintenance activities meliputi regular updates, security patches, dan capacity planning. Automated backup dan disaster recovery procedures harus diimplementasikan untuk memastikan business continuity. Documentation yang comprehensive dan knowledge transfer kepada operations team juga essential untuk sustainability jangka panjang.
Tren dan Masa Depan Orkestrasi Data
Industri orkestrasi data terus berkembang dengan inovasi-inovasi yang menarik. Machine learning integration menjadi tren utama dimana platform mulai menggunakan AI untuk optimasi otomatis terhadap workflow performance. Predictive analytics dapat digunakan untuk forecasting resource needs dan automatic scaling decisions.
Edge computing juga mempengaruhi evolusi platform orkestrasi, dengan kebutuhan untuk processing data closer to the source. Hybrid architectures yang combine cloud dan edge processing menjadi increasingly popular untuk use cases yang memerlukan ultra-low latency atau have strict data residency requirements.
Serverless computing paradigm juga mulai diadopsi dalam orkestrasi data, memungkinkan organizations untuk fokus pada business logic tanpa worry tentang underlying infrastructure management. Function-as-a-Service (FaaS) models dapat provide cost-effective solutions untuk workloads yang intermittent atau unpredictable.
Sustainability dan Green Computing
Aspek sustainability menjadi increasingly important dalam design platform orkestrasi modern. Energy efficiency dan carbon footprint reduction menjadi consideration utama dalam pemilihan infrastructure dan optimization strategies. Green computing practices seperti intelligent workload scheduling dan resource optimization dapat significantly reduce environmental impact.
Platform future akan likely incorporate more sophisticated algorithms untuk minimize energy consumption while maintaining performance requirements. Integration dengan renewable energy sources dan carbon offset programs juga menjadi trend yang emerging dalam industry.
Kesimpulan
Platform untuk orkestrasi alur kerja data real-time telah menjadi enabler krusial bagi transformasi digital organisasi modern. Dengan kemampuan untuk memproses dan menganalisis data secara real-time, platform ini memberikan competitive advantage yang signifikan dalam decision making dan operational efficiency. Investment dalam platform orkestrasi yang tepat dapat menghasilkan ROI yang substantial melalui automation, improved data quality, dan faster time-to-insight.
Keberhasilan implementasi platform orkestrasi memerlukan careful planning, proper technology selection, dan commitment terhadap best practices dalam operations dan maintenance. Dengan considering faktor-faktor seperti scalability, integration capabilities, dan long-term sustainability, organizations dapat membangun data infrastructure yang robust dan future-ready untuk mendukung growth dan innovation di era digital.
